British PM Johnson to return to work from Monday



LONDON: British Prime Minister Boris Johnson will go back to work on Monday after having recovered from novel coronavirus, a spokeswoman at the Downing Street spokeswoman had confirmed.

PM Johnson, 55, spent at an intensive care for three nights in early April.

He will take back control of the government which is under pressure from the economic fallout of shutdowns.

Britain has recorded as many as 20,000 deaths from coronavirus so far.

PM Johnson’s stand-in leader Dominic Raab has come under criticism and faced harsh questions over how the country will ease the lockdown.

The Prime Minister was taken to St Thomas’s Hospital in London suffering from novel coronavirus symptoms on April 5.
